Quick Cool
This function selects the lowest cooling temperature. This
gives you colder storage temperatures.
This function is relevant to the fridge section Fig. 1 (A)
You can also reach lower temperatures in the 4-star freezer.
Use:
-
Cool large amounts of food quickly.
Freeze food.
-
Activating/deactivating the function
u Using the 4-star freezer: activate the function when you
add the goods.
u Using the fridge section: activate the function when you
add the goods.
u Activating/deactivating (see 6.2 Control concept) .
The function automatically turns off. The appliance goes
back to normal mode. The temperature adjusts itself to the
set level.
Vacation function
This function minimises the energy consumption during
an extended absence. The temperature of the refrigerator
compartment is set to 15 °C and this is displayed on the
status screen when the temperature has been reached.
Use:
-
Save energy if you plan to be away for a while.
Avoid coming home to bad smells and mould.
-
Activating/deactivating the function
u Empty everything from the fridge section.
u Activating/deactivating (see 6.2 Control concept) .
w On: Fridge temperature is raised.
w Off: the previously set temperature is restored.
Sabbath mode
Use this function to activate or deactivate the Sabbath
mode. If you activate this function, some electronic func‐
tions will be switched off. This allows your appliance to
meet religious requirements on Jewish holidays such as the
Sabbath.
Appliance status with active Sabbath mode
The status display continuously shows Sabbath mode.
All functions in the display except the Deactivate Sabbath
mode function are locked.
Active functions remain active.
The display stays lit when you close the door.
* Depending on model and options
Appliance status with active Sabbath mode
The interior lighting is off.
Reminders are disabled. The set time intervals are paused.
Reminders and warnings are not displayed.
There is no door alarm.
There is no temperature alarm.
The defrost cycle only works for the specified time without
taking account of appliance use.
After a power failure, the appliance returns to Sabbath
mode.

WARNING
Danger of food poisoning from spoiled food!
If you have activated Sabbath mode and a power failure
occurs, no message appears in the status display about the
power failure. Once the power is restored, the appliance
continues to operate in Sabbath mode. The power failure
may mean that food spoils and the consumption of this food
could lead to food poisoning.
After a power failure:
u Do not consume food that was frozen and has thawed
out.
